Canadian forestry gets billion dollar subsidy

19/06/2009
The Canadian forestry industry is set to benefit from a billion-dollar subsidy payment from the government to counter rebates received by the US industry.

The Canadian industry is suffering as a result of the global financial crisis but the US is taking in hundreds of millions each week as part of a $7 billion rebate programme which rewards alternative fuel use. The proposals will see Canada benefitting from around a billion dollars of investment; and British Columbia is set to receive more than $400,000 as it is responsible for over 40% of the country’s pulp and paper production.

Natural resource minister, Lisa Raitt, says the subsidy programme "will lay the groundwork for a greener, more sustainable future for Canada's pulp and paper industry.”

The industry is likely to welcome the programme but is keen to see the aid come quickly and be distributed fairly.

The subsidy programme from Ottawa will reward green energy projects and environment improvement projects. Pulp and paper milling can result in energy generation and in this way, pulp and paper industries can qualify for the green projects subsidies.
